Headless CMS 2023: ¿Qué es? | ¡Beneficios y casos de uso!

Publicado: 2023-01-27

En estos días, los clientes quieren comunicarse con las marcas a través de múltiples canales y dispositivos, como aplicaciones móviles, chatbots, asistentes digitales, realidad aumentada o virtual, y otros.

Sin embargo, tener CMS y herramientas para servir contenido para cada nuevo canal ya no es una estrategia viable y no es escalable.

Por lo tanto, las empresas de todos los tamaños se están mudando cada vez más a una plataforma basada en SaaS conocida como sistema de gestión de contenido sin cabeza, para mejorar la velocidad y la agilidad de las experiencias digitales.

Headless CMS , también conocido como Decoupled CMS, es un sistema de gestión de contenido que funciona independientemente de la capa de presentación de front-end.

A diferencia de los sistemas CMS tradicionales, los CMS sin cabeza son API que administran y almacenan contenido, mientras que una capa de presentación separada es responsable de mostrar ese contenido en el sitio web.

Este desacoplamiento permite a los desarrolladores crear un sitio web o una aplicación con cualquier tecnología que elijan y hacer que el CMS administre el contenido.

Headless CMS

Créditos: https://dri.es/headless-cms-rest-vs-jsonapi-vs-graphql

Tabla de contenido

Beneficios de usar un CMS sin cabeza 2023

1. Entrega de contenido omnicanal

Con un CMS tradicional, el contenido a menudo está vinculado a una plantilla o tema específico, lo que puede dificultar la visualización de ese contenido en diferentes plataformas o dispositivos.

Con un CMS sin encabezado, el contenido se desacopla de la capa de presentación, lo que facilita mucho la visualización de ese contenido en diferentes plataformas, como web, dispositivos móviles o incluso dispositivos IoT.

Esto permite un mayor alcance y compromiso con los clientes, así como la capacidad de ofrecer experiencias personalizadas en diferentes plataformas. También permite a las empresas ser más ágiles en sus enfoques de marketing y les ahorra tiempo y dinero.

2. Desarrollo preparado para el futuro

Cuando se trata de la implementación, un CMS sin cabeza se puede integrar con cualquier tipo de interfaz o aplicación, incluidos web, dispositivos móviles, IoT y más.

Esto permite a los desarrolladores apegarse a sus herramientas y marcos de trabajo favoritos, como JavaScript, React, Vue.js, Angular y otros, para crear la parte frontal de la aplicación y conectarla al CMS autónomo mediante API.

Como resultado, esto ayuda a reducir los costos de desarrollo y también permite a los desarrolladores trabajar de forma independiente en el front-end y el back-end, y también les permite realizar cambios en el front-end sin afectar el back-end y viceversa. .

Además, elimina gran parte de las molestias innecesarias con las que los desarrolladores tienen que lidiar y pone su enfoque y energía creativa en tareas más útiles.

3. Proceso de desarrollo simplificado

Con un CMS tradicional, los desarrolladores a menudo tienen que trabajar tanto con el propio CMS como con la capa de presentación, lo que puede agregar complejidad al proceso de desarrollo.

Con un CMS sin cabeza, los desarrolladores pueden concentrarse en el desarrollo de back-end del CMS, mientras que los diseñadores y los desarrolladores de front-end pueden concentrarse en la capa de presentación.

Esto puede conducir a tiempos de desarrollo más rápidos y una mejor experiencia general del usuario.

4. Velocidad y escalabilidad

Un CMS sin cabeza es más escalable que un sistema tradicional porque desacopla el front-end y el back-end. Esto significa que el front-end y el back-end se pueden escalar de forma independiente, lo que permite un mayor control sobre cómo se asignan los recursos.

Además, esto permite que el frente se almacene en caché, lo que reduce la cantidad de solicitudes que deben realizarse en el backend, lo que ayuda a mejorar la experiencia del usuario y reduce la carga en el backend.

5. No se requiere experiencia técnica

Con Headless CMS, su código y contenido están separados. Esto permite a los creadores de contenido crear y administrar contenido fácilmente sin tener que preocuparse por cómo se verá cuando se muestre en el sitio web o en la capa de presentación.

6. Seguridad mejorada

Debido a que el contenido sin encabezado está separado de la capa de presentación, es menos vulnerable a los ataques porque la API se puede ocultar detrás de una o más capas de código, lo que la hace más segura.

Por ejemplo, al no exponer el back-end a terceros, se reduce el riesgo de piratería y filtraciones de datos.

7. Reutilización

La arquitectura desacoplada de un CMS sin cabeza permite la reutilización de contenido en múltiples plataformas y canales. Esto puede incluir aplicaciones web y móviles, chatbots, realidad virtual y aumentada, y más.

8. Experiencia de usuario mejorada

Un CMS sin cabeza permite una experiencia de usuario más personalizada. Al separar el front-end y el back-end, los desarrolladores pueden crear una experiencia más personalizada para diferentes dispositivos y plataformas.

9. Mejor optimización de motores de búsqueda

Un CMS sin cabeza permite un mejor control sobre el contenido, lo que puede ayudar a mejorar la optimización del motor de búsqueda. Esto se debe a que el front-end se puede optimizar para los motores de búsqueda, mientras que el back-end se puede usar para administrar y actualizar el contenido.

10. Mejor integración con otras herramientas

Un CMS sin cabeza se puede integrar con otras herramientas, como motores de análisis, búsqueda y personalización, lo que permite una mayor funcionalidad y un mejor análisis de datos.

11. Rentable

Un CMS sin cabeza puede ser más rentable que los sistemas monolíticos tradicionales. Esto se debe a que permite ciclos de desarrollo e implementación más rápidos, y también puede reducir la necesidad de habilidades y recursos especializados.

Los 10 principales casos de uso para Headless CMS 2023

1. Entrega de contenido multicanal

Headless CMS permite la creación de contenido una vez y luego publicarlo en múltiples canales, como web, móvil, IoT, etc. Esto puede ahorrar tiempo y recursos, y mejorar la coherencia entre canales.

2. Aplicaciones web progresivas (PWA)

Las PWA son aplicaciones web que funcionan como aplicaciones móviles nativas y se puede acceder a ellas sin conexión. Se puede usar un CMS sin encabezado para entregar contenido para PWA, lo que permite una experiencia de usuario perfecta en diferentes dispositivos.

3. internet de las cosas

Los dispositivos de Internet de las cosas (IoT), como los parlantes inteligentes, se pueden integrar con un CMS autónomo para brindar contenido personalizado a los usuarios.

4. Rediseño del sitio web

Un CMS sin cabeza permite rediseñar un sitio web sin tener que reconstruir todo el CMS. La parte delantera se puede rediseñar mientras que la parte trasera permanece sin cambios.

5. Comercio electrónico

Un CMS sin cabeza se puede integrar con plataformas de comercio electrónico para administrar la información del producto y otro contenido, lo que permite una experiencia de usuario perfecta.

6. Personalización

Headless CMS permite la entrega de contenido personalizado, al aprovechar los datos de varias fuentes para entregar contenido que se adapta al usuario individual.

7. Arquitectura de microservicios

Con un CMS autónomo, las distintas partes de un sitio web o una aplicación se pueden crear y gestionar de forma independiente, lo que facilita su escalado y mantenimiento.

8. Desacoplar el equipo de frontend y backend

Un CMS sin cabeza permite una mayor flexibilidad para los equipos de frontend y backend, ya que pueden trabajar de forma independiente sin afectar el trabajo del otro.

9. Accesibilidad

Headless CMS permite la accesibilidad y traducción de contenido a múltiples idiomas.

10. Análisis

El CMS sin cabeza se puede integrar con herramientas de análisis para rastrear la participación del usuario y obtener información sobre el comportamiento del usuario.

Para concluir, un CMS headless es una poderosa herramienta que puede proporcionar una gran flexibilidad y eficiencia en la gestión y visualización de contenido digital.

Con la capacidad de desacoplar el contenido de la capa de presentación, los CMS autónomos facilitan la visualización de contenido en diferentes plataformas y dispositivos y agilizan el proceso de desarrollo.

Estos beneficios hacen que un CMS autónomo sea una opción ideal para las organizaciones que necesitan administrar y entregar contenido a través de múltiples plataformas y canales.

Enlaces rápidos:

  • ¿Qué es Siberian CMS? Creador de aplicaciones de código abierto para iPhone y Android
  • Revisión de MotoCMS con cupón de descuento
  • Revisión de DragDropr: ¿Es el mejor creador de páginas para CMS?